Tim Farron’s departure was not a happy, dignified one. Hustled into going by the first stirrings of a putsch, he issued a lengthy farewell statement just as the horror of the Grenfell Tower fire was becoming clear. The timing was not his choice, his team insisted. The respectable Lib Dem showing on election night should have meant a measured handover— Farron can be proud that he delivered 12 MPs, up from the eight seats won in 2015.
